NAMI Tri-Valley provides support, resources, and education programs for people struggling with mental illness or people who have family members who struggle with mental illness. NAMI is the National Alliance on Mental Illness, and NAMI Tri-Valley serves the Livermore, Dublin, and Pleasanton communities.
